Unhappy Engine check light is on? HELP

Hi there im like kinda nervous cuz my light has never gone on before but yesterday i installed a BBK cai and it says your cai doesnt requre a tune and i was wondering if it says it doesnt require a tune y would the light turn on...... Please explain y is it on or wat happen ...please and thank you in advance......

Make sure all your plugs are tight going to your maf.
If one isnt tight your light will come on.
Also while your in there make sure everything is tight and connected well.
And make sure your maf is on the right way.

what kind of programmer are you using? the cai will make your run lean which will trip the light. there is a tune for your mustang and to be honest you should use it. it's not good to run lean. also what other stuff have you done to it?

With both intake and exhaust opened up and more free flowing you might have pushed the 'doesn't need a tune' CAI just past the point to where it does need one.

Like A7X1031 said, since you don't have a tuner run it to Autozone and get the code read and then put the stock airbox back in for now. If you're running lean you can cause several thousand dollars damage for a couple hundred dollar CAI. Run the stock airbox 'til you get things sorted out as to the problem.
